Orinda Aquatics Inc
To promote competitive swimming for the benefit of athletes of all abilities (minimum ages or standards may apply), in accordance with the standards and under the rules prescribed by the Federation Internationale de Nation Amateur ("FINA"), United States Swimming, Inc. ("USS"), Pacific Swimming, Inc. ("Pacific Swimming"), and USA Master's Swimming.
